Deng Minwen

Deng Minwen, of the Dong minority, is Senior Researcher at the Institute of Ethnic Literature at the Chinese Academy of Social Sciences; his research interests are Dong Oral Tradition and its literary representations. His books include On The Literary History of China’s Many Ethnic Groups (1995), The History of Literary Relations between Southern Ethnic Groups (vol. 2, 2001) and On Divine Judgments (1991). He is editor-in-chief of The History of Dong Literature (1998) and co-author of The Kingdom Without a King: A Study on Dong Kuan (1995).
